am Posted in iPhone, Technology, That's Life Tagged App Store, Error 1004, Error 1004 please try again later, iPad, iPhone, iTunes By all accounts, from googling the experiences of others, issues from clock time to full memory can trigger the iPhone and iPad App Store "Error 1004 please try https://slapphappe.wordpress.com/2011/09/27/app-store-error-1004-please-try-again-later-on-iphone-and-ipad/ again later". I was simply trying to update my installed apps. The problem hit me simultaneously on http://blog.tom.aratyn.name/post/34276220486/mac-app-store-error-1004 iPhone and iPad -- which is a hint that the problem is server side. No amount of waiting to try again later made a difference. Not resetting the time. Nor restarting my iPhone/iPad. Nor rebooting my iPhone/iPad. Nor deleting a couple of videos to recover memory (even though I wasn't short on available RAM to start with). Nor even switching between 3G and WiFi, thereby iphone 4 excluding router issues. For me the solution was different and simple. I needed to sign out of my iTunes/App Store account and back in again … Settings>Store 1. Click on your Apple ID 2. Sign Out 1. Sign in 2. Use Existing Apple ID 1. Enter your iTunes email (username) and password 2. Click Ok Restore your settings -- or make new choices. I was able to do this by making sure that my automatic downloads was on, on my app section. I didnt even have to log out. Not sure thAt this will work for all but it worked for me. I must also mention that I previously downloaded an app on my iPhone and then when trying to download it on my iPad I would get the error from the app store 1004. After turning on the automatic sync on my iPad and then trying to redownload the app from the store it worked. The first didn’t go where I wanted and the second was Sisyphean. The internet had some solutions including “wait it out” and “delete the cache, cookies, and prefs” but none of worked for me. I finally noticed that in the dock the apps which wouldn’t update were greyed out and had an X in their corner. Initially I avoided it not wanting to delete them or make some ugly surprise happen. It finally connected for me that ONLY those icons which needed resuming were greyed out. I hazarded clicking the x and was prompted (by the app store) whether I wanted to cancel the download or delete the app. Cancelling the download eliminated the problem. Apps are updated and all’s well with the world. Except apple support and UX, of course. They dropped the ball on this.
